Here's a tip I often give out to help people kick the cola habit-

Take your favorite flavor of 100% juice, and fill a glass about 2/3 of the way full. Then, simply top off the glass with Gerolsteiner or similar naturally sparkling mineral water.

If you like a bit of "bite", start with a little ground ginger in the glass.

The possibilities are endless, and it's worlds healthier than commercial soda pop.
